Stairs
Bunk beds that have stairs or ladders are a great option to give your kids more space to sleep. When you are looking for bunk beds with stairs, consider what kind of room layout you'd like to design. You may want to measure the dimensions of your children's bedroom to make sure that the new bunk bed can fit comfortably without blocking windows, doors or furniture already in the room. Stairs should be solid and secure, and fastened securely to the bunk bed frame. This will prevent them from moving when children climb up and down.
A slide can be incorporated into bunk beds to add enjoyment to the space. Slides are an excellent way for kids to have fun with their friends and can be removed once they reach a certain age. Stairs that have built-in drawers are another option worth considering, as they can aid in keeping the area clean and organized for kids and parents alike.

If you're building a bunk set that will be used by children aged 6 and over It's an ideal idea to think about using stairs instead of a ladder for the top bunk. Stairs have a handrail for children to hold onto when climbing up to the bed. This makes them more secure than ladders. Additionally, children of all ages are able to navigate stairs with ease than a ladder.
Bunk beds with stairs look more elegant than those with ladders. They are typically constructed from solid wood and have gorgeous finishes to complement any bedroom decor. These stairs can be stained or painted to match the color scheme of the bunk beds. You can also shield them with several thin coats polyurethane to keep the wood looking good and avoid splinters.
If you are planning to stain your ladder-stairs first, apply a primer to aid in making the color stick. Follow the product's instructions on application and drying time.
